Freigeben über


PartialTagHelper Klasse

Definition

Rendert eine Teilansicht.

public ref class PartialTagHelper : Microsoft::AspNetCore::Razor::TagHelpers::TagHelper
[Microsoft.AspNetCore.Razor.TagHelpers.HtmlTargetElement("partial", Attributes="name", TagStructure=Microsoft.AspNetCore.Razor.TagHelpers.TagStructure.WithoutEndTag)]
public class PartialTagHelper : Microsoft.AspNetCore.Razor.TagHelpers.TagHelper
[<Microsoft.AspNetCore.Razor.TagHelpers.HtmlTargetElement("partial", Attributes="name", TagStructure=Microsoft.AspNetCore.Razor.TagHelpers.TagStructure.WithoutEndTag)>]
type PartialTagHelper = class
    inherit TagHelper
Public Class PartialTagHelper
Inherits TagHelper
Vererbung
PartialTagHelper
Attribute

Konstruktoren

PartialTagHelper(ICompositeViewEngine, IViewBufferScope)

Erstellt einen neuen PartialTagHelper.

PartialTagHelper(ICompositeViewEngine, IViewBufferScope)

Rendert eine Teilansicht.

Eigenschaften

FallbackName

Ansicht, um nachzuschlagen, wenn die von Name angegebene Ansicht nicht gefunden werden kann.

For

Ein Ausdruck, der anhand des aktuellen Modells ausgewertet werden soll. Kann nicht zusammen mit Modelverwendet werden.

Model

Das Modell, das in die Teilansicht übergeben werden soll. Kann nicht zusammen mit Forverwendet werden.

Name

Der Name oder Pfad der Teilansicht, die in der Antwort gerendert wird.

Optional

Wenn dies optional ist, wird das Taghilfsprogramm nicht ausgeführt, wenn die Ansicht nicht gefunden werden kann. Andernfalls wird ausgelöst, dass die Ansicht nicht gefunden wurde.

Order

Wenn eine Gruppe von ITagHelpers ausgeführt wird, werden ihre Init(TagHelperContext)"s" zuerst in der angegebenen Orderaufgerufen. Dann werden ihre ProcessAsync(TagHelperContext, TagHelperOutput)"s" im angegebenen Orderaufgerufen. Niedrigere Werte werden zuerst ausgeführt.

(Geerbt von TagHelper)
ViewContext

Ruft die der ViewContext ausgeführten Ansicht ab.

ViewData

Ein ViewDataDictionary , der in die Teilansicht übergeben werden soll.

Methoden

Init(TagHelperContext)

Initialisiert den ITagHelper mit dem angegebenen context. Ergänzungen von Items sollten innerhalb dieser Methode vorgenommen werden, um sicherzustellen, dass sie vor dem Ausführen der untergeordneten Elemente hinzugefügt werden.

(Geerbt von TagHelper)
Process(TagHelperContext, TagHelperOutput)

Führt synchron mit TagHelper dem angegebenen context und outputaus.

(Geerbt von TagHelper)
ProcessAsync(TagHelperContext, TagHelperOutput)

Führt die mit dem TagHelper angegebenen context und outputasynchron aus.

Gilt für: